Fairings[edit]

The text states the Partenair had fairings above each wheel, but all the photos only show a fairing (the streamlined cover) over the front center wheel. JEH (talk) 23:13, 31 December 2011 (UTC)[reply]

I supplied the photos - they were all taken of the prototype on one specific day, 29 May 2004. Wheel pants are made from fibreglass and are easily removed. The KitPlanes refs cited all show photos with 3 wheel pants installed, so obviously the day I photographed it they had just removed two for some reason. - Ahunt (talk) 23:19, 31 December 2011 (UTC)[reply]
